## What is the Capacity of Network Capacity Planning?

Network Capacity Planning, within the context of cryptocurrency, options trading, and financial derivatives, fundamentally addresses the ability of underlying infrastructure—be it blockchain networks, trading platforms, or clearing systems—to handle anticipated transaction volumes and data throughput. It’s a proactive assessment, not merely a reactive response to congestion, incorporating projections of future demand based on market trends, regulatory changes, and technological advancements. Effective planning ensures operational resilience, minimizes latency, and maintains the integrity of order execution, particularly crucial during periods of high volatility or significant market events. This involves a holistic view, considering computational resources, bandwidth limitations, and the scalability of consensus mechanisms.

## What is the Architecture of Network Capacity Planning?

The architectural considerations for Network Capacity Planning in these domains are layered and complex. For cryptocurrency networks, it necessitates evaluating the block size, transaction processing speed, and the efficiency of the chosen consensus protocol, such as Proof-of-Stake or Proof-of-Work. In options trading, it involves assessing the order book depth, matching engine performance, and the capacity of data feeds to disseminate real-time market information. Financial derivatives systems require robust infrastructure to manage complex pricing models, risk calculations, and regulatory reporting obligations, demanding a distributed and fault-tolerant design.

## What is the Algorithm of Network Capacity Planning?

Sophisticated algorithms are integral to accurate Network Capacity Planning. These algorithms leverage historical transaction data, order flow patterns, and predictive analytics to forecast future demand. Machine learning models can be trained to identify correlations between market variables and network load, enabling dynamic resource allocation. Simulation techniques, such as Monte Carlo methods, are employed to stress-test systems under various scenarios, revealing potential bottlenecks and informing infrastructure upgrades. Furthermore, algorithms optimize routing protocols and data compression techniques to maximize throughput and minimize latency.
